The Interfaith Community Thanksgiving Service is a special time for members of many faiths to come together in a spirit of thanksgiving and community.  All are welcome and encouraged to attend.

Why should you participate in a Thanksgiving Service?  Through gratefulness, we say yes to life. We say yes to God. We fully respond to each given moment and all its simple and complex blessings: the red apple, the hot coffee, the favorite sweater; the car that starts, the friend that calls, the sun that shines. We make a choice to focus on what it is that we love about life. Even, and especially, when times are tough.

During the Interfaith Community Thanksgiving Service there will be an opportunity for a Thanksgiving offering to benefit victims of Hurricane Sandy. Attendees may bring blankets to be donated to the relief efforts in New York and New Jersey and/or make financial contributions to the cause. 

The event is hosted by the Brecksville - Broadview Heights Ministerial Association. For more information, please contact Rev. Stephanie Pace, St. Matthew’s Episcopal Church, 440-526-9865.
